IMPLEMENTATION OF CHAT-BASED CONSULTATION SYSTEM ON THE RESPINOS HEALTH APPLICATION

The COVID-19 pandemic has forced healthcare facilities to limit their number of visits. An alternative for the community to interact with doctors is through telemedicine systems. Currently, many telemedicine systems provide a remote consultation service but lack the feature to examine the patient...

Full description

Saved in:
Bibliographic Details
Main Author: Wira Murti, Jonet
Format: Final Project
Language:Indonesia
Online Access:https://digilib.itb.ac.id/gdl/view/76860
Tags: Add Tag
No Tags, Be the first to tag this record!
Institution: Institut Teknologi Bandung
Language: Indonesia
id id-itb.:76860
spelling id-itb.:768602023-08-19T08:40:36ZIMPLEMENTATION OF CHAT-BASED CONSULTATION SYSTEM ON THE RESPINOS HEALTH APPLICATION Wira Murti, Jonet Indonesia Final Project COVID-19, remote consultation, telemedicine, patient, doctor, Respinos, chat, agile. INSTITUT TEKNOLOGI BANDUNG https://digilib.itb.ac.id/gdl/view/76860 The COVID-19 pandemic has forced healthcare facilities to limit their number of visits. An alternative for the community to interact with doctors is through telemedicine systems. Currently, many telemedicine systems provide a remote consultation service but lack the feature to examine the patients directly. Thus, the Respinos device was developed to perform remote patient monitoring function. The device currently available does not yet have a remote consultation service integrated with it. Therefore, a telemedicine application is implemented to integrate the Respinos device with a chat-based consultation system called the Respinos Health. The development of a chat-based consultation system is intended to facilitate remote consultations between patients and doctors on the Respinos Health application. The development process of Respinos Health, specifically the chat- based consultation system, is done using the Agile method implemented over 43 sprints. The result is a chat-based consultation system that has chat communication feature using the XMPP protocol, user authentication and authorization features using the OpenID Connect and role-based access control, consultation scheduling mechanisms through immediate and scheduled consultation features, consultation slot management feature, consultation request creation feature using the reservation pattern, doctor search feature, consultation cancellation and reminder features, consultation notes management feature, as well as consultation history feature. The chat-based consultation system is implemented into a chat server component that uses Openfire technology and an API server component that uses Node.js and Express technologies, both of which are integrated into the patient and doctor applications. The testing process of the chat-based consultation system is carried out through unit testing using both specification-based and program-based approaches, as well as integration testing using a bottom-up approach. text
institution Institut Teknologi Bandung
building Institut Teknologi Bandung Library
continent Asia
country Indonesia
Indonesia
content_provider Institut Teknologi Bandung
collection Digital ITB
language Indonesia
description The COVID-19 pandemic has forced healthcare facilities to limit their number of visits. An alternative for the community to interact with doctors is through telemedicine systems. Currently, many telemedicine systems provide a remote consultation service but lack the feature to examine the patients directly. Thus, the Respinos device was developed to perform remote patient monitoring function. The device currently available does not yet have a remote consultation service integrated with it. Therefore, a telemedicine application is implemented to integrate the Respinos device with a chat-based consultation system called the Respinos Health. The development of a chat-based consultation system is intended to facilitate remote consultations between patients and doctors on the Respinos Health application. The development process of Respinos Health, specifically the chat- based consultation system, is done using the Agile method implemented over 43 sprints. The result is a chat-based consultation system that has chat communication feature using the XMPP protocol, user authentication and authorization features using the OpenID Connect and role-based access control, consultation scheduling mechanisms through immediate and scheduled consultation features, consultation slot management feature, consultation request creation feature using the reservation pattern, doctor search feature, consultation cancellation and reminder features, consultation notes management feature, as well as consultation history feature. The chat-based consultation system is implemented into a chat server component that uses Openfire technology and an API server component that uses Node.js and Express technologies, both of which are integrated into the patient and doctor applications. The testing process of the chat-based consultation system is carried out through unit testing using both specification-based and program-based approaches, as well as integration testing using a bottom-up approach.
format Final Project
author Wira Murti, Jonet
spellingShingle Wira Murti, Jonet
IMPLEMENTATION OF CHAT-BASED CONSULTATION SYSTEM ON THE RESPINOS HEALTH APPLICATION
author_facet Wira Murti, Jonet
author_sort Wira Murti, Jonet
title IMPLEMENTATION OF CHAT-BASED CONSULTATION SYSTEM ON THE RESPINOS HEALTH APPLICATION
title_short IMPLEMENTATION OF CHAT-BASED CONSULTATION SYSTEM ON THE RESPINOS HEALTH APPLICATION
title_full IMPLEMENTATION OF CHAT-BASED CONSULTATION SYSTEM ON THE RESPINOS HEALTH APPLICATION
title_fullStr IMPLEMENTATION OF CHAT-BASED CONSULTATION SYSTEM ON THE RESPINOS HEALTH APPLICATION
title_full_unstemmed IMPLEMENTATION OF CHAT-BASED CONSULTATION SYSTEM ON THE RESPINOS HEALTH APPLICATION
title_sort implementation of chat-based consultation system on the respinos health application
url https://digilib.itb.ac.id/gdl/view/76860
_version_ 1822995087557132288